The Watusi are native to Africa, commonly known as Royal Ox. Although they can seem very calm, they are very aggressive, especially if they smell blood. We have often had to run them off of a freshly harvested animal and they seem to be driven crazy from the smell of the blood. Some of the Watusi we have harvested here on the Lonesome Bull Ranch could fit 6 men inside the horns!

The Ankole-Watusi derives from central African cattle of the Ankole group of Sanga cattle breeds. Some of these were brought to Germany as zoo specimens in the early twentieth century, and from there spread to other European zoos.

Some were imported to the United States, and in 1960 a herd was started in New York State by crossbreeding some of them with an unrelated Canadian bull. A breed society, the Ankole Watusi International Registry, was set up in 1983 and in 1989 a breed standard was drawn up. In 2016 the total number for the breed was thought to be approximately 1500 head, some 80% of them in the United States.
